The LLM Professional Practice with a Solicitors Qualification Examination (SQE) pathway offers you the opportunity to prepare for SQE1, obtain an introduction to SQE2 legal skills and acquire some Qualifying Work Experience (QWE). In the process, you will gain an internationally recognised LLM qualification.Law and non-law graduates who want to qualify as solicitors in England and Wales. You will prepare for your SQE exams while gaining practical legal skills.

Entry requirements
For international students
Students must achieve an undergraduate degree of class 2:2 or above and will then be placed into either the law graduate or non-law graduate stream. For the law graduate stream, students must have a LLB (Hons) degree, a Common Professional Examination/Graduate Diploma in Law, or a combined studies degree including the foundation law subjects. Students who have reached the appropriate level of qualification with the Institute of Legal Executives are also eligible for consideration for admission to the law graduate stream. For the non-law graduate stream, students must achieve an undergraduate degree with a classification of 2:2 or above in any subject. All applications for the full-time LLM Legal Practice (SQE) must be made online via the Central Applications Board at www.lawcabs.ac.uk. Applications for the part-time LLM Legal Practice (SQE) can be made using our online application form.
